地震电磁疑似异常特征提取与地震相关性分析

Extraction of Seismo-Magnetic Anomalies Suspected and Analysis of the Relationship with the Earthquake

【作者】 张轶鹏

【导师】 乔晓林;

【作者基本信息】 哈尔滨工业大学 , 信息与通信工程, 2010, 硕士

【摘要】 强震前存在地震电磁疑似异常现象已被大量强震震例所证实,分析地震电磁疑似异常已经成为地震短临预测的有效手段。伴随着国际地震电磁卫星的迅速发展,研究地震电磁特征提取方法,统计分析地震电磁疑似异常,对地震短临预测及我国自主研发电磁卫星都具有重要意义。论文基于法国DEMETER卫星的数据和资料,采用电磁波传播分析和极化分析方法,对截止频率下方出现的类似平面波辐射的地震电磁疑似异常进行了提取,并进行了如下几方面的研究:本文首先研究了电磁波极化概念,对完全极化波和非完全极化波的概念和分析方法进行了阐述,为采用SVD技术深入分析了在电离层高度截止频率下电磁辐射的极化特性和波传播特性。通过特征分析确定了电磁时频幅度和极化度等参数的分割门限,通过门限检测方法将几千个数据文件的数量降低到几百个。其次,论文研究了C均值聚类方法、ISODATA算法和形态学区域生长等目标分割算法,通过理论分析各种算法的优缺点,最终确定采用形态学区域生长算法。该方法运算速度快,适用于大数据量的检测。实验结果表明,该方法可以有效提取地震电磁异常信号,并具有较高的执行效率。最后,论文对2006年全年8700个数据文件采用本文算法进行了检测,并对提取出来的地震电磁疑似异常信息与地震事件进行了统计分析,研究了地震电磁疑似异常发生的经纬度、时间、极化、传播方向等特征参数与地震事件的相关性,为地震电磁前兆分析提供了科学合理的统计结果。论文成果不仅提供了可靠的地震电磁疑似异常检测方法,对于从海量数据中提取少量有用信息而言,也提供了研究典范。

【Abstract】 It has been proved by a lot of seismic cases that the seismo-electromagnetic abnormal phenomena occur before the strong earthquakes. The seismo-electromagnetic precursors have been considered as an effective means of the short-term and imminent earthquake prediction. At the same time, accompanying with the swift development of the internationalseimo-electromagnetic satellites, it is important for imminent earthquake prediction and our own seimo-electromagnetic satellites to carry out research on processing method for seimo-electromagnetic data on the DEMETER spacecraft.By using the data and documents of the satellite DEMETER, take the methods of analysis of electromagnetic wave propagation and polarization, we extract seismo-electromagnetic abnormal phenomena, which is similar to the plane-wave radiation, under the cut-off frequency, the following specific research:Firstly, the concept of Electromagnetic wave polarization was introduced, include the concept and the analysis methods of completely polarized wave and non-fully polarized wave, and the polarization features as well as the propagation features of electromagnetic radiation under the cut-off frequency in ionosphere use the SVD(Singular value decomposition) technology. The segmentation threshold of electromagnetic spectrum as well as the polarization were determined by the feature analysis, for reduce the amount of data.Secondly, the C-mean algorithm、ISODATA(Iterative Selforganizing Data Analysis Techniques Algorithm) algorithm and the region growing on Morphological were introduced, we finally take region growing on Morphological because for its speed. Experimental results show that this method can effectively extract abnormal seismic electromagnetic signals and implementation of high efficiency.Finally, we use this algorithm detected 8700 data files collected in 2006, then Statistical Analysis the relationship between the seismo-electromagnetic abnormal phenomena and seismic events,. We also statistical analysis the relationship between Latitude and longitude, time, polarization, propagation direction of characteristic parameters of abnormal phenomena and seismic events, for the reason science.The result of article provide a detect method of seismo-electromagnetic abnormal phenomena, and it is also a good model how to extract a little information from mass data files.
